Alex Rodriguez's girlfriend, Jaclyn Cordeiro, is a fitness instructor with a background in nursing. She attended the University of Windsor and then worked in critical care nursing.

After the COVID-19 pandemic, Cordeiro changed her profession and got into fitness training. She has since helped many individuals with her six-week transformation fitness program, JacFit.

On Friday, Cordeiro posted her exercise routine for legs while posing in front of a mirror, flexing her sculpted leg muscles. The following is her routine:

  • Leg press high & wide: 3 sets, 15 reps
  • Hip width stance
  • Toes neutral position: 10 reps
  • Toes outward: 10 reps
  • Toes inward: 10 reps
  • Cable kickbacks: 3 sets, 15 reps
  • Leg extension: 3 sets, 15 reps
  • Walking lunges: 3 sets, 10 reps per leg
  • Hip thrust: 3 sets, 15 reps
"Gym is my kind of therapy," Cordeiro said at the end of her workout video.

Jaclyn Cordeiro reveals how her six-week challenge started and turned into JacFit community

Alex Rodriguez and Cynthia Scurtis are among those who have benefitted from Jaclyn Cordeiro's fitness regime. A-Rod has advocated for the program by posting about his lifestyle change, thanks to his girlfriend.

During an interview with Trainer Revenue Multiplier host Jaime Filler, Cordeiro explained how her six-week challenge started with word-of-mouth marketing before seeing an influx of clients.

Cordeiro told Filler (7:04 onwards):

"I started off with maybe eight clients from my local area because they knew me from the gym and from competing. And, you know, just through word of mouth.
"Essentially, what happened is that the six-week challenge became very successful with my clients and the concepts I taught. I had to create phase two to retain phase one clients moving into phase two, then phase three, and phase four. It eventually became what it is now, but it was really just a process of building as I went along."

Cordeiro also mentioned that she had no previous experience in entrepreneurship but that she trusted her gut. Eventually, her love for nursing faded away and she developed a new fulfillment and passion with JacFit.
